Subject: Validator plugin system — what you need to know

You're on call for Gatewren starting Monday. Quick notes: validators load at startup from the plugin registry; a bad plugin fails closed and blocks the ingest pipeline. Most pages are caused by third-party plugins timing out — bump the timeout, don't disable validation. Restarting the loader clears stuck plugins 90% of the time. Escalate to the Fernhollow data team if schemas drift. Troubleshooting steps are on the page linked below.

runbook for badug-kadup: https://confluence.zemvarlabs.internal/projects/browse/display/projects/bd1b

Handover — Vexler partner SFTP drop

Ownership moves to you today. Drop runs hourly from Vexler's end into the intake bucket via the relay host. Watch for zero-byte files; their exporter flakes on Mondays. Creds live in the ops vault, path noted in the runbook. Vault auto-seals after 48h idle. Support escalations go to the on-call rotation, not me. If the vault is sealed when you need it, unseal with the recovery passphrase below.

recovery phrase for tadug-fafof: zorwyn-kasion

Subject: Updated string-extraction script for Polyglotta

Team, the translation-string extraction script now escapes placeholder tokens before writing to the catalog, closing the injection path flagged in last week's review. It also refuses to process files outside the declared source roots and logs any skipped paths for audit. Please review the diff before we cut the localization bundle. The verified build for this change is noted below.

build token for fahap-yagag: htk3_d09

Hi Tobin,

Handover notes on the LinguaPull extraction script ahead of your security review. It scans the Fernwheel monorepo for translatable strings and writes them to a staging bucket; credentials are scoped read-only since last sprint. One open item: the regex allowlist hasn't been audited since the refactor. Flag anything suspicious and I'll triage. Questions during the review can go to the address below.

escalation mailbox, bafog-fafog: ulador@paliqlabs.internal